As Zhao Wuji's voice fell, Xiao Wu, who had been about to hurl Zhao Wuji away, suddenly turned pale. She discovered that her legs could no longer move the opponent beneath her. A tremendous force suddenly surged forth, forcibly dragging her backward-flipping body back down.

Just as Zhao Wuji was about to land, Zhu Zhuqing, who had been lurking in the shadows and waiting for an opportunity, struck once more.

Although Zhao Wuji's First Soul Skill had sent her flying earlier, he had held back, so Zhu Zhuqing's injuries were not serious. With Ning Rongrong's support skill on top of that, Zhu Zhuqing was now in even better condition than before.

Thus, just as Zhao Wuji was about to land and his vigilance dropped, Zhu Zhuqing attacked again.

Like last time, Zhu Zhuqing went all out the moment she struck. Her First and Second Soul Skills activated simultaneously, and in what seemed like an instant, she appeared behind Zhao Wuji. Her hands became sharp, thorn-like cat claws as she launched an attack at the vital points on his back.

However, just as Zhu Zhuqing attacked, Zhao Wuji repeated the same trick. The First Soul Ring beneath his feet lit up again.

In an instant, intense golden light erupted from Zhao Wuji once more. As the golden light flared, the Blue Silver Grass that had been wrapped around him was almost completely destroyed in a moment.

Xiao Wu was caught up in it as well. Her legs were still hooked around Zhao Wuji's neck, so in the next moment, she cried out miserably and was blasted away.

Zhu Zhuqing, on the other hand, had learned her lesson. She had been prepared for Zhao Wuji's First Soul Skill this time, and even her earlier attack had merely been a feint.

Thus, almost at the same instant the golden light appeared, Zhu Zhuqing vanished from where she stood.

The moment Zhao Wuji finished releasing his First Soul Skill, Zhu Zhuqing appeared at his side again.

A white dagger patterned with red and black in her hand stabbed viciously toward Zhao Wuji's chest.

When Zhu Zhuqing struck now, she actually had a bit of Li Ang's flair from when he had felled Dai Mubai with a single stab.

Unfortunately, Zhu Zhuqing's opponent was not some useless fool like Dai Mubai, but Zhao Wuji, a level seventy-six Soul Sage.

Thus, just as Zhu Zhuqing's dagger was about to fall, two fingers appeared abruptly and firmly pinched the dagger she had thrust out. No matter how hard Zhu Zhuqing tried, she could not move it even a fraction.

"Ah, young people these days are really terrifying. It was just that close to..." After blocking Zhu Zhuqing's attack, Zhao Wuji looked utterly smug, just about to show off.

But in the very next moment, the blade of the dagger in Zhu Zhuqing's hand suddenly shot out and stabbed viciously into Zhao Wuji's chest.

Zhao Wuji:...

Zhu Zhuqing:( ̄︶ ̄)

The dagger Li Ang had given Zhu Zhuqing, forged from the fang of a Ten Thousand Year Black King Snake, appeared to have its blade and handle fused into a single piece.

However, many things could not be judged by appearances alone.

This dagger was one of them.

This seemingly ordinary dagger had been personally forged by a Forging Grandmaster Li Ang had hired years ago.

During the forging process, the Forging Grandmaster had not only enhanced the potency of the snake venom carried by the dagger, but had also added an ejection mechanism at Li Ang's suggestion.

All it took was Soul Power to trigger the mechanism on the dagger, and its blade would shoot out instantly. The force unleashed in that instant was considerable.

Clearly, Zhao Wuji had never expected such a thing to happen, so he was caught off guard and got hit.

Moreover, the blade had struck exactly where Zhu Zhuqing had attacked earlier.

Although Zhu Zhuqing's previous attack had failed to break Zhao Wuji's defense, it had not been entirely ineffective.

Compared to other areas, Zhao Wuji's defense there was clearly weaker. Combined with the explosive force released when the blade shot out—

Zhao Wuji's defenses were finally breached. Though he had suffered only a superficial wound, that was already enough.

The venom of the Ten Thousand Year Black King Snake had been enhanced. Even a Soul Sage would be affected after being poisoned.

Of course, Zhao Wuji was still a high-level Soul Master, far stronger than Dai Mubai had been.

So while the Ten Thousand Year Black King Snake's venom would affect him, it would not be fatal. It would also take some time to take effect.

Zhu Zhuqing clearly knew this, so the instant the blade fired, she had already fled.

Zhu Zhuqing's decision was extremely wise, because in the next moment, Zhao Wuji roared and slapped at her.

This time, he even used his Second Soul Skill, the Vajra Power Palm.

Terrifying power exploded in an instant. Infused by his Soul Ring, his palm turned golden and doubled in size as it smashed toward Zhu Zhuqing's position.

Fortunately, Zhu Zhuqing reacted quickly enough and had long been prepared to retreat, so the palm strike did not land squarely.

Even so, merely being grazed by it felt awful. Zhu Zhuqing felt the Soul Power throughout her body churn violently, and the Soul Power within her became chaotic.

Fortunately, Zhao Wuji did not press his advantage. It was not that he did not want to.

It was because, at the same time Zhu Zhuqing succeeded, Tang San seized the opportunity and attacked Zhao Wuji.

First came the embroidery needles controlled by Sunflower Soul Power. In an instant, these needles seemed to come alive as they rapidly flew toward every vital point on Zhao Wuji's body.

That was not all. In the next moment, Willow Leaf Blades, Locust Stones, Money Darts, Bone Penetrating Nails, and all kinds of hidden weapons blossomed beneath Tang San's Sky Full of Flowers technique. Some flew straight, some diagonally, and some circled around behind him, but they all had only one target in the end: Zhao Wuji's body.

In an instant, Zhao Wuji was drowned beneath all manner of hidden weapons and embroidery needles that seemed to possess life. He no longer had time to continue his pursuit.

Relying on his terrifying physical body to withstand every attack, Zhao Wuji shot toward Tang San like a cannonball, intending to deal with this troublesome brat first.

However, while Zhao Wuji's defense was astonishing, his speed was truly lacking. At the very least, he could not keep up with Tang San, who cultivated the Sunflower Manual and moved like Gui Mei.
